**Mgmt Meeting Minutes — Retiring the Brightline Range**

Quick recap for sales leads at Fenholt Supplies: we agreed to retire the Brightline fixture range by year-end. Remaining stock moves to clearance pricing next month, and accounts on standing orders get migrated to the Lumetta range. Trade-in incentives were approved in principle. The confidential note on next steps sits just below.

board note of bajof-bajeg: The pricing group signed off on a budget of $13.4 million for Project Sildor. The renewal with Lamixek Holdings closes at $48.9 million a year, 49 percent above the last contract.

To: Dispatch Desk. Subject: Payslips — Gantry Hollow site. The Gantry Hollow crew has no printer, so payroll printed their slips here. Sealed envelope, marked confidential, at the dispatch counter. Needs to ride out on tomorrow's first run. Site lead Orla will meet the driver at the gatehouse. Driver releases the envelope only after Orla says this phrase:

dispatch memo: the sorox briiel courier leaves the druius kelion fenir gorvan ralael rusius julwyn belwyn ledger at gate 4220 under passcode 637242

Management Meeting Minutes — Supplier Renewal

Present: Dario, Lena, Okafor, Mireille. Apologies: Tomas.

Main item was the Greyfen Logistics contract, up for renewal in March. Lena walked us through the numbers — their rates are up 9%, but switching costs to Bramble Freight would eat most of the savings in year one. Okafor will push for a two-year cap on increases; Dario wants a break clause at eighteen months. Finance to model both scenarios by next Friday. Before the modelling starts, everyone should read the confidential note below.

board note of bawep-tajef: Queniusek Systems plans to raise the Quenvan list price by 53.1 percent in March. The pricing group signed off on a budget of $176.4 million for Project Drueth. The renewal with Casionix Partners closes at $142.5 million a year, 8.3 percent below the last contract. Project Fraax slips by six weeks because of the tooling delay.